How they compare
Japan currently reports 23.67 Mt CO2e against 20.05 Mt CO2e in Iran, Islamic Republic of, a difference of 3.62 Mt CO2e.
That makes Japan's figure about 1.2 times Iran, Islamic Republic of's.
Across all 35 years both countries report, Japan has been ahead every year.
Iran, Islamic Republic of ranks 11th and Japan ranks 8th of 154 countries.
Japan has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Iran, Islamic Republic of | Japan |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 2.57 Mt CO2e | 53.75 Mt CO2e | 51.18 Mt CO2e | Japan |
| 2000s | 6.06 Mt CO2e | 32.87 Mt CO2e | 26.8 Mt CO2e | Japan |
| 2010s | 10.38 Mt CO2e | 19.94 Mt CO2e | 9.56 Mt CO2e | Japan |
| 2020s | 17.8 Mt CO2e | 22.94 Mt CO2e | 5.14 Mt CO2e | Japan |
Averages of every year both report within each decade.

About this data
A measure of annual emissions of fluorinated gases (hydrofluorocarbons (HFCs), perfluorocarbons (PFCs), and sulphur hexafluoride (SF6)), from industrial processes including IPCC 2006 codes 2.B Chemical Industry, 2.C Metal Industry, 2.E Electronics Industry, 2.F Product Uses as Substitutes for Ozone Depleting Substances, 2.G Other Product Manufacture and Use The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
